Jason Michael Fulop, 51, of Chesterfield, passed away on Saturday, April 26, 2025. He was preceded in death by his parents, Alex and MaryAnne (Yurechko) Fulop. He is survived by his wife and soulmate of nearly 28 years, Kara Norment Fulop; children, Abigail “Abby” (24) and her fiancé, John Davis, Carter (21), Julianna “Jules” (16), and Brooks (11); and brother, Alex J Fulop and his wife, Carol, and sons Brandon and Brian.
Jason was born July 19, 1973 in McKeesport, PA and was a graduate of HS Elizabeth Forward class of 1991. He earned his BS in Mechanical Engineering from Va Tech 1995, going on to become a Licensed Professional Engineer (PE). Jason dedicated 30 years to his career in HVAC Commercial design and sales. He was known as the Professor by his peers at Hoffman & Hoffman and as the Skipper on his beloved FatBoys adult soccer league team. He will be remembered as being funny for his perfectly timed, mic drop, dry humor moments. He enjoyed avid soccer playing, coaching, refereeing and being a loyal fan. Jason loved his Jeep, Pearl Jam, Jeopardy, and a competitive poker game, but loved his family beyond measure.
He was loving, honorable, brilliant, stoic, loyal, family centered, often saying, “I keep my cards close to my vest”. He was the creator of “Daddy School” and the “Fulop Language”. He was incredibly family-centered and “he was the best dad ever”.
Jason fought colon cancer from July 2022 to May 2023,but learned of its confirmed return April 2024. It had tragicly metastasized to Stage 4. He endured numerous surgeries – always with a brave face and stoic strength. Jason fought courageously until his last moments, where he was able to pass peacefully in his home with his family.
